    Abstract: The present invention discloses a functional powder delivery device for precise locating and quantifying when delivering the functional powder to a site in need in a patient. Meanwhile, the device avoids negative pressure effect in the output catheter when airflow is switched, and thus prevents pollution or jam in the output catheter due to splash or back flow of body fluid. The device ensures tube clearance of the output catheter by maintaining continuous airflow, and a special design of airflow switch allows switching to airflow of large volume to carry the powder when required. Through continuous positive airflow in the tube system, the functional powder can be delivered to the site in need by a continuous powder flow, which overcomes drawbacks of the delivery devices in prior arts. In addition, the design of foot pedal can help endoscopist for a solo operation. The serial connecting parts can adapt for various size of bottles of various types of functional powder.

    Abstract: The present invention discloses a guiding element and a guiding assembly for spinal drilling operation. The guiding element is configured to be dispose at a vertebra which comprises a lamina. The guiding element comprises a main body, two connection parts, and two locating parts. The main body has two stand portions and each of the stand portion comprises a clamping part. Each of the connection parts comprises a first end and a second end. The two first ends extends away from each other. Each locating part connects to each stand portion through each connection part. Each clamping part comprises two hook portions. Each side, which is configured to be in contact against the vertebra, of the hook portions has a curvature corresponding to the surface of the lamina, so that the main body is configured to be disposed at the lamina and across the vertebra through the hook portions.

    Abstract: A method and a system of determining the deviation of dynamic position are provided. The determining method includes the follow steps. First, a server receives a plurality of first position data from a first mobile device. Next, the server receives a plurality of second position data from a second mobile device. Then, the server transmits the first position data to the second mobile device. Thereon, the server transmits the second position data to the first mobile device. Later, the server determines whether the first mobile device and the second mobile device deviate from each other according to the first position data and the second position data.
